Output ef53906e4fe5e99a83bc741e2ae1b42b87ce0b4dff4e2a171872e1e499ddafc9:1

value
25040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ebde01680e98adf64062d530151a35ac400e7ba OP_EQUAL
address
A6uctUAGYxWiH6ArzHx9VQMj4tzWmnMsBu
transaction
ef53906e4fe5e99a83bc741e2ae1b42b87ce0b4dff4e2a171872e1e499ddafc9